Machining Technician (CNC) Apprentice
Safe operation of CNC milling machines & lathes
Setting up of tooling, & managing tool wear in operation
Setting up machines, CNC milling & lathes
Monitoring of machine once in operation
Learning to read & edit CNC programmes
Learning to understand & read technical drawings & specifications
Use of a wide range of technical measuring equipment used in the control of quality
Training:
This is a 4 year apprenticeship. In year 1, you will attend Nelson and Colne College on full year term time college attendance. In year 2 - 4, you will work in company 4 days a week and attend Nelson and Colne College on day release.
